結合JPA和MyBatis-Plus進行開發,可以借助JPA提供的持久化功能和MyBatis-Plus提供的SQL操作功能,實現更高效的數據操作。
以下是結合JPA和MyBatis-Plus進行開發的步驟:
集成JPA和MyBatis-Plus:在項目中引入JPA和MyBatis-Plus的依賴,配置數據源和實體類映射關系。
定義實體類:使用JPA定義實體類,并添加@Entity和@Table注解進行實體類與數據庫表的映射。
使用MyBatis-Plus的Mapper:編寫MyBatis-Plus的Mapper接口和Mapper.xml文件,實現對數據庫的增刪改查操作。
使用JPA的Repository:使用JPA的Repository接口實現對實體類的持久化操作。
結合JPA和MyBatis-Plus:在業務邏輯中結合JPA和MyBatis-Plus進行操作,可以根據具體需求選擇使用JPA或MyBatis-Plus進行數據操作。
通過結合JPA和MyBatis-Plus進行開發,可以充分利用兩者的優勢,提高開發效率和數據操作性能。同時,也可以根據具體業務需求靈活選擇使用JPA或MyBatis-Plus進行數據操作,實現更加靈活和高效的開發。